Wow. Huge, almost creme-brulee-like bouquet. No sense of tannins here, very round, ripe, not overly complex but very expressive on the palate. Long, long finish. Not a long-ager, but a total crowd pleaser for drinking now and over the next 5-8 years.

Napa-Noma, May 2008: Troncais barrel fermented with F15 yeast if you're interested. Sappy balanced red currant fruit. Less overt compared to the Missouri oak tasted alongside.

5/13/2008 - OneLastSyrah wrote:
Napa-Noma, May 2008: Missouri oak u-stave barrel. Sweet crème brulee and caramel on top of red currant fruit.
